One such actor is Sir Anthony Hopkins, who at the age of 83, continues to be a force to be reckoned with in the film industry. Known for his powerful performances in films such as “The Silence of the Lambs” and “The Remains of the Day,” Hopkins has cemented his status as one of the greatest actors of his generation.

Another legendary actor who shows no signs of slowing down is Clint Eastwood. At 91 years old, Eastwood has not only had a successful career as an actor but has also made a name for himself as a director and producer. His films, such as “Unforgiven” and “Million Dollar Baby,” have received critical acclaim and have solidified his place in Hollywood history.

One cannot talk about iconic actors without mentioning Morgan Freeman. At 84 years old, Freeman’s deep and distinctive voice continues to captivate audiences. From his roles in “The Shawshank Redemption” to “Driving Miss Daisy,” Freeman has proven time and time again that he is a true master of his craft.

Robert De Niro: A Living Legend

Robert De Niro, a retired male actor, is considered one of the greatest actors of all time. With a career spanning over five decades, De Niro has become an iconic figure in the film industry.

As an elderly veteran actor, De Niro has portrayed a wide range of characters, showcasing his versatility and talent. From his early breakthrough role in “Mean Streets” to his unforgettable performances in “Taxi Driver,” “Raging Bull,” and “Goodfellas,” De Niro has consistently delivered powerful and memorable performances.

Now in his mature years, De Niro continues to impress audiences with his acting skills. Despite being over 70, he remains active in the industry, taking on challenging roles and demonstrating his dedication to his craft.

De Niro’s contributions to cinema have earned him numerous accolades, including two Academy Awards and the AFI Life Achievement Award. His commitment to his craft and his ability to bring characters to life have solidified his status as a living legend.

With his intense performances and his ability to captivate audiences, Robert De Niro has left an indelible mark on the world of film. His talent, dedication, and longevity make him a true icon among actors.

Al Pacino: The Master of Intensity

Al Pacino is a veteran male actor who has captivated audiences for decades with his intense performances. Born on April 25, 1940, Pacino is now a mature and senior actor in the industry. Despite being in his 70s, he continues to deliver powerful and memorable performances.

Pacino rose to fame in the 1970s with his role as Michael Corleone in “The Godfather” trilogy. His portrayal of the complex character earned him critical acclaim and established him as one of the greatest actors of his generation. Since then, he has starred in numerous iconic films, including “Scarface,” “Serpico,” and “Dog Day Afternoon.”

Although Pacino has officially retired from the stage, he remains active in the film industry. His talent and dedication to his craft have earned him numerous accolades, including an Academy Award for Best Actor for his role in “Scent of a Woman.” He has also been nominated for several other prestigious awards throughout his career.

Michael Caine: A Timeless Talent

Male Actors Over 70: Legends of the Silver Screen

Michael Caine is an iconic actor who has had a long and successful career in the film industry. Born on March 14, 1933, he is now over 70 years old and still actively working in the industry. Despite his mature age, Caine has not retired and continues to showcase his talent on the silver screen.

Known for his distinctive voice and charismatic presence, Caine has become one of the most respected actors of his generation. With a career spanning over six decades, he has portrayed a wide range of characters, from suave spies to gritty gangsters. Caine’s versatility and ability to bring depth to his roles have earned him critical acclaim and numerous awards.

As a senior actor, Caine brings a wealth of experience and wisdom to his performances. His portrayal of complex and nuanced characters has captivated audiences around the world. Despite his elderly status, Caine’s passion for acting remains undiminished, and he continues to take on challenging roles that showcase his talent.

Caine’s contributions to the film industry have not gone unnoticed. He has received numerous accolades throughout his career, including two Academy Awards and a Golden Globe. His talent and dedication have made him a true legend of the silver screen.

Even at his age, Caine shows no signs of slowing down. He continues to take on new projects and deliver memorable performances. His commitment to his craft and his ability to connect with audiences make him a timeless talent in the world of acting.
